MIRON-CANELO, José A.; IGLESIAS-DE SENA, Helena and ALONSO-SARDON, Montserrat. Valuation of the students about his formation in the Faculty of Medicine. Educ. méd. [online]. 2011, vol.14, n.4, pp.221-228. ISSN 1575-1813.
Aim: To know and to analyze the knowledge and opinions that have the pupils of sixth year of medicine on the education-learning of the master. Subjects and methods: A transversal study is realized from the primary information contributed by a survey that is applied to 225 pupils of sixth degree of Medicine. Results: Of the whole of polled pupils, 208 (95%; 95% CI = 95 ± 3) is not considered to be formed to exercise the Medicine, and 214 (96%; 95% CI = 96 ± 3) is not qualified to exercise the Medicine. The global quality of the formation received in the pregrade is valued by 55% (95% CI = 55 ± 7) of the pupils by an average score of 3 for a scale of 1-5. With regard to the formative components, the theoretical formation is valued very positively and negatively the clinical and social skills and the communication, the attitudes and the aspects related to the management. The MIR test has determined as methodology. For 169 pupils (75%; 95% CI = 75 ± 6), the MIR test has determined formation so much contained (70%; 95% CI = 70 ± 3) as methodology (58%; 95% CI = 58 ± 6). Conclusions: Globally, a positive evolution exists between 1999 and 2008-2010. The results of this work reveal the need to introduce changes in the process of education learning of the Medicine that the effective formation and satisfaction improve.
